Picking the purchase level: Counting my Users & Sysadmins

The trial period has been successful and I want to subscribe. But, which plan.

I have two people as sysadmins (change design) and 12 people that need to search, filter, add, change and delete data.

Are the 12 “external users” and do I simply need two “users”? I’m paying for the users, so the difference is important.

In Ragic, a user to Ragic means the one can access to database, no matter to design or build up the system, or to add and edit data, or to view data.

Users can be managed into different user groups, and be granted to different access rights.

An account is a Ragic database account created for an organization, it can contain many users, which are actually user e-mail and password combinations that a person can log in with. The users within your organization would be internal users.
And the other people who are not in your organization, like clients, vendors, partners, freelancers, etc, but would like to access your Ragic account, can be external users, which are under limited privilege, but it’s free and without amount limit.
